Arlo Chicago Chicago, IL Full Time or Summary Description Arlo Hotels, an independent lifestyle hotel, is now actively seeking a dynamic Food and Beverage Manager. Are you passionate about people, driven by purpose, and clever in your approach? If so, keep on reading!! Here at Arlo, we strive to create a sense of awe that leaves those we touch wanting more.”….. The Food and Beverage Manager assists in organizing, managing, and administering all operational aspects of the Food and Beverage Outlets. Responsibilities And Authorities Approach all encounters with guests and team members in a friendly, service-oriented manner. Maintain regular attendance in compliance with Arlo Hotel standards, as required by scheduling, which will vary according to the needs of the hotel. Maintain high standards of personal appearance and grooming, which includes proper dress and when working. Always comply with Arlo Hotels standards and regulations to encourage safe and efficient hotel operations. Be visible and interact with guests and team members to provide consistently high levels of quality service. Specific Duties Ensure that all aspects are communicated to the culinary team and to all other managers in the F&B department to ensure all details are correctly maintained. Manage the Open Table system with the host team members, ensuring accuracy of all guest reservations and shift reservations. Assist Host team members with greeting and seating guests during peak times of operation. Organize all documentation for shift work on a daily basis, including pre-shift reports, daily training topics, shift floor plan, requisitions for beverages, food,and sundries, and manage labor on a daily basis. Ensure all staff are meeting all established standards of service. Monitor and test the service skills of staff, retrain and reinforce all standards on food and quality and service details daily. Provide feedback and appraisals, as necessary. Monitor and maintain cleanliness of dining rooms and work areas; communicate issues of safety, cleanliness, or malfunctions to appropriate departments; manage maintenance/safety issues to completion. Plan and conduct meetings for outlets on a monthly basis to ensure staff is correctly communicated with and that staff are consistently trained and well-motivated. Attend interdepartmental meetings to ensure good cross communication between departments. Assist in the development of marketing initiatives, menu items, and other items to stimulate growth in sales for each outlet and a variety of the latest market developments. Be aware of and assist in controlling current budgeted and forecasted revenues, payroll, and product costs. Ensure all current Accounting and People Services policies are being adhered to. Report any issues or grievances to the Director of Outlets and or People Services. Assist in maintaining all Micros programming for food and beverage outlets. Monitor hotel activities and troubleshoot problems. Operate word processing program in the computer. Perform any general cleaning tasks using standard hotel cleaning products to adhere to health standards. Additional duties as necessary and assigned. Requirements Must be able to stay on your feet for 8 hours plus Must work well in stressful, high-pressure situations and environments. Must be effective at listening to, understanding and clarifying concerns and issues raised by team members and guests. Must be able to prioritize departmental functions to meet due dates and deadlines. Must be able to work with and understand financial information and data, and basic arithmetic function Must be able to convey information and ideas clearly with strong oral and written communication skills. Must maintain complete confidentiality in regards to team member relations and any access to sensitive information or data. Must have strong attention to detail, ability to prioritize departmental functions to meet due dates and deadlines. Education High school or equivalent education required. Bachelor’s Degree preferred. Experience Two (2) years of Food & Beverage Manager experience or equivalent. One (1) year of Restaurant Leadership in Hotel environment experience or equivalent. Knowledge Must have strong computer skills and financial knowledge required. Certifications Manager Alcohol awareness certification and Manager Food Service permit as required by local or state government agency. Loading Job Application... Mills Auto Group Raleigh, NC Full Time or Here we grow again!!!!! Mills Auto Group is looking for F&I managers to join our growing auto group. Our automotive group is looking for high performing finance managers. We are a 19 year old privately held auto group that is growing and promoting from within, these are coveted spots. Lucrative highly performance driven pay plan with F&I friendly sales processes and desks are the perfect recipe for the perfect candidates success. We offer a professional working environment with continuous training for our team members of our successful, privately held, dealership group. Finance & Insurance Manager is responsible for coordinating the sale of finance & insurance programs to customers. This position works with the sales team and financial institutions to provide financial services to dealership customers. Duties & Responsibilities Include Selling financing & insurance products and services to our customers Attaining goals for gross production of financial services/products Review customer credit applications for completeness Utilize menu selling process 100% Ensure all necessary documentation is complete for each deal Maintain Customer Satisfaction scores at or above company standards Communicate with sales team to ensure every customer is handled efficiently and professionally Ensure compliance with all laws & regulatory obligations Ensure completion & submission of all financial documents where applicable Maintain effective communication with team members Promote and help maintain outstanding CSI Requirements Must have at least 1 years of automotive dealership F&I experience including secondary financing. Proven track record Strong record of positive customer satisfaction results Team oriented Excellent track record with financial institutions Valid driver's license with good driving record Submit to and successfully complete MVR & background check & pre-employment drug test. Benefits Include Group medical plan Group short term disability & life insurance Various voluntary benefit plans Closed on Sundays Continuous training Opportunities for career advancement within our automotive group of multiple dealership locations. We are an Equal Opportunity Employer and a Drug Free Workplace About The Dealership Mills Auto Group understands rapid growth in the automotive space. Family-owned and operated for the past 19 years, we are proud to have grown from 1 store to 25. Most of our team of dedicated and motivated leaders have been with us since the beginning, most starting in entry-level roles themselves. We understand the importance of employee growth and promote from within often. In addition to career development, at Mills Auto Group, you are recognized for your accomplishments. We have quarterly and yearly employee appreciation events. We participate in Degrees at Work and fund our employees’ college education! We encourage you to get involved with our community outside of the office as well – whether you choose to participate in the Boys and Girls Club, Wounded Warriors, or Support Future Leaders, there is always an opportunity for our employees to help our community. Classic Ford Lincoln - Columbia Columbia, SC Full Time or Assistant Parts Manager Company: Classic Ford Lincoln - Columbia Compensation: $75,000 - $90,000 per year Job Location: Columbia, South Carolina Description Of The Role The Assistant Parts Manager will play a crucial role in the operations of our dealership. They will assist the Parts Manager in overseeing the parts department, ensuring efficient inventory management, and delivering exceptional customer service. Responsibilities Assist the Parts Manager in managing the day-to-day operations of the parts department Coordinate with suppliers to ensure timely delivery of parts Maintain accurate inventory records and perform regular stock checks Assist in training and supervising parts department staff Handle customer inquiries and provide assistance in finding the right parts Process orders and handle parts returns Requirements Prior experience in automotive parts department management Strong knowledge of automotive parts and their functionalities Excellent problem-solving and organizational skills Ability to work in a fast-paced and demanding environment Strong communication and customer service skills Benefits Competitive salary Health insurance Retirement plan Paid time off Employee discounts About The Company Classic Ford Lincoln - Columbia is a premier Ford and Lincoln dealership serving the Columbia, South Carolina area. We are committed to providing exceptional service and a wide selection of quality vehicles and parts. Join our team and be part of a dynamic and successful automotive dealership!
